Definition
- Noun:
- A spoken or written representation of someone or something: The act of giving details about the appearance, nature, or qualities of a person, object, place, or event.
- A sort, kind, or class: A category or variety to which something belongs, often used with words like 'every', 'any', or 'all'.
Examples of Usage
- Noun (Representation):
- He gave a detailed description of the suspect to the police.
- The book's description of the jungle was so vivid I could almost feel the humidity.
- Noun (Sort/Class):
- The store sells bags of every description—leather, canvas, and nylon.
- We encountered problems of the worst description during the project.
Advanced Usage
- "To answer (to) the description of": To match the details given about someone or something.
- The man they arrested answers to the description of the robber.
- "Beyond description": So extreme or beautiful that it is impossible to describe adequately.
- The beauty of the sunset was beyond description.
Variants and Related Words
- Describe (verb): To give a detailed account or representation of something in words.
- Can you describe what happened?
- Descriptive (adjective): Serving or seeking to describe.
- She wrote a highly descriptive essay about her hometown.
Synonyms
- Account: A report or description of an event or experience.
- Portrayal: A depiction or description of someone or something in a particular way.
- Category: A class or division of people or things regarded as having particular shared characteristics.
Related Phrases
- Job description (noun phrase): A formal account of the responsibilities and duties associated with a specific job role.
- Please review the job description before your interview.
